What kind of school is Seaside Christian Academy?
Seaside Christian Academy (SCA) is an independent community Christian School supporting the churches of Worcester and Sussex counties.

What type of curriculum does SCA follow?
The State of Maryland has approved our program because we voluntarily follow the Maryland State Standards. The basis of our curriculum is the world famous Abeka Curriculum, which is used by thousands of schools.

What sports are offered at SCA?
SCA currently has teams for volleyball, boys' and girls' basketball, and soccer for students in grades 5-8, and soccer for younger children through Upward Soccer.

What kind of certification is required for SCA teachers?
SCA teachers must be certifiable by the Association of Christian Schools International (ACSI), or the State of Maryland or a state whose certification is recognized by Maryland, or the teacher must be working towards such certification.

Is SCA accredited?
SCA is recognized by the State of Maryland for our Pre-school and up to the Eighth Grade, and is a member of the Association of Christian Schools, International (ACSI).

Do SCA students do any State testing?
SCA students are tested annually with the Stanford Achievement Test, 10th Edition, which is used by schools around the world. This tool monitors student achievement and gives valuable feedback to teachers, parents, and students.

Does the school provide transportation?
No.

Do SCA students have to wear uniforms?
Yes. The students at SCA wear shirts purchased from the school, and have certain other guidelines which are spelled out in the Student Handbook.
